PEARCE is seeking a SGRE Level 5 Certified Maintenance Travel Wind Technician
, with a commitment to excellence, strong desire to succeed and learn new skills utilizing established procedures, with the highest regard for health, safety, and environmental compliance. As a SGRE Level 5 Certified Maintenance Travel Wind Technician
, you are required to be a Family 2 Maintenance Technician who is certified on the G129, G132 and G145 platforms. Family 3 Maintenance Technician is certified on G80, G90, G110 and G114 platforms. Expected to be able to perform maintenance, minor to medium repairs (non‑crane related), design modifications/retrofits and special projects, all following procedures. Must maintain certifications in all areas required by position.

The position is 100% travel.

Physical/Work Environment

At PEARCE safety is our number one concern. Candidates must be able to comply with OSHA/DOT Standards.

  • Ability and willingness to climb a wind turbine vertically at least 300 feet.
  • Maintain a weight between 120 and 280 pounds, including clothing and boots, for OSHA safety compliance.
  • Lift and move equipment as needed (more than 50 pounds).
  • Work in an indoor or outdoor environment in adverse weather conditions with blowing pollen, dust, and grasses.
